界面处理方法、装置及系统制造方法及图纸

技术编号:14053479 阅读:104 留言:0更新日期:2016-11-26 02:38
本发明专利技术提供了一种界面处理方法、装置及系统,其中,该方法采用获取机顶盒的应用程序的界面和/或该应用程序的操作描述信息;根据该描述信息生成与该描述信息对应的界面呈现元素;接收对该界面呈现元素的属性和/或业务逻辑的编辑指令,根据该编辑指令对该界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;发送该新的应用程序的界面和/或新的操作描述信息给该机顶盒,解决了机顶盒的程序界面和操作复杂,使用不方便的问题,提高了用户使用的便利性。

【技术实现步骤摘要】

本专利技术涉及通信领域,具体而言,涉及一种界面处理方法、装置及系统
技术介绍
随着移动互联网的迅猛发展和OTT(Over The TOP)/IPTV机顶盒的大规模面世,以智能手机/Pad为代表的多屏移动终端与OTT机顶盒之间的交互成为较为热门的终端互动方式。OTT机顶盒尤其Android机顶盒的应用以及机顶盒自身的界面(Launcher)样式已经非常绚丽,而且随着用户行为分析、大数据等技术的日趋成熟,机顶盒的界面和操作越来越复杂,用户操作的电视栏目列表以及使用较为频繁的应用快捷方式越来越多,在相关技术中,还不能提供自定义,个性化的用户操作界面和业务处理方式。针对相关技术中机顶盒的程序界面和操作复杂,使用不方便的问题,目前尚未提出有效的解决方案。
技术实现思路
针对相关技术中机顶盒的程序界面和操作复杂,使用不方便的问题,本专利技术提供了一种界面处理方法、装置及系统,以至少解决上述问题。根据本专利技术的一个方面,提供了一种界面处理方法,包括:获取机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;根据所述描述信息生成与该描述信息对应的界面呈现元素;接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。进一步地,所述生成新的应用程序的界面和/或新的操作描述信息之后,所述方法还包括:将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。进一步地,所述接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令包括以下至少之一:接收对控件位置、大小的拖拽指令;接收对控件的皮肤、贴图的替换指令;接收对控件的点击、长按的业务编辑指令。根据本专利技术的另一个方面,还提供了一种界面处理方法,包括:终端构建机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;所述终端根据所述描述信息生成
与该描述信息对应的界面呈现元素;所述终端接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;所述终端发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。进一步地,所述根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息之后,所述方法还包括:将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。进一步地,所述终端接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令包括以下至少之一:接收对控件位置、大小的拖拽指令;接收对控件的皮肤、贴图的替换指令;接收对控件的点击、长按的业务编辑指令。根据本专利技术的另一个方面,还提供了一种界面处理方法,包括:接收编辑后的新的应用程序的界面和/或新的操作描述信息,其中,所述新的应用程序的界面和/或新的操作描述信息是终端通过对机顶盒的应用程序的界面和/或操作描述信息对应界面呈现元素的属性和/或业务逻辑进行编辑生成;根据所述新的应用程序的界面和/或新的操作描述信息对所述机顶盒应用程序的界面和/或业务操作进行动态调整。进一步地,所述根据所述新的应用程序的界面和/或新的所述应用程序的操作描述信息对所述机顶盒应用程序的界面和/或业务操作进行动态调整包括以下至少之一:根据所述描述信息中的界面样式和/或布局对应用程序中预置的界面呈现元素进行展示或隐藏,并调整所述界面呈现元素的布局和/或尺寸;接收所述界面和/或操作描述信息的相关图片替换界面呈现元素的皮肤贴图;根据所述描述信息中规定的界面呈现元素操作,定义界面呈现元素的业务操作。根据本专利技术的另一个方面,还提供了一种界面处理装置,包括:获取模块,用于获取机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;第一编辑模块,用于根据所述描述信息生成与该描述信息对应的界面呈现元素;第一生成模块,用于接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;第一发送模块,用于发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。进一步地,所述装置还包括:第一链接模块,用于将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。进一步地,所述第一生成模块包括以下至少之一:第一元素属性单元,用于接收对控件位置、大小的拖拽指令;所述第一元素属性单元,还用于接收对控件的皮肤、贴图的替换指令;第一元素业务单元,用于接收对控件的点击、长按的业务编辑指令。根据本专利技术的另一个方面,还提供了一种界面处理装置,包括:构建模块,用于终
端构建机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;第二编辑模块,用于所述终端根据所述描述信息生成与该描述信息对应的界面呈现元素;第二生成模块,用于所述终端接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;第二发送模块,用于所述终端发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。进一步地,所述装置还包括:第二链接模块,用于将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。进一步地,所述第二生成模块包括以下至少之一:第二元素属性单元,用于接收对控件位置、大小的拖拽指令;所述第二元素属性单元,还用于接收对控件的皮肤、贴图的替换指令;第二元素业务单元,用于接收对控件的点击、长按的业务编辑指令。根据本专利技术的另一个方面,还提供一种界面处理装置,包括:接收模块,用于接收编辑后的新的应用程序的界面和/或新的操作描述信息,其中,所述新的应用程序的界面和/或新的操作描述信息是终端通过对机顶盒的应用程序的界面和/或操作描述信息对应界面呈现元素的属性和/或业务逻辑进行编辑生成;调整模块,用于根据所述新的应用程序的界面和/或新的操作描述信息对所述机顶盒应用程序的界面和/或业务操作进行动态调整。进一步地,所述调整模块包括:元素属性调整单元,用于根据所述描述信息中的界面样式和/或布局对应用程序中预置的界面呈现元素进行展示或隐藏,并调整所述界面呈现元素的布局和/或尺寸;所述元素属性调整单元,还用于接收所述界面和/或操作描述信息的相关图片替换界面呈现元素的皮肤贴图;元素业务调整单元,用于根据所述描述信息中规定的界面呈现元素操作,定义界面呈现元素的业务操作。根据本专利技术的另一个方面,还提供一种界面处理系统,其特征在于,包括:终端和机顶盒;所述终端与所述机顶盒之间通过局域网或广域网进行连接;所述终端包括上述的装置;所述机顶盒包括上述的装置。通过本专利技术,采用获取机顶盒的应用程序的界面和/或该应用程序的操作描述信息;根据该描述信息生成与该描述信息对应的界面呈现元素;接收对该界面呈现元素的属性和/或业务逻辑的编辑指令,根据该编辑指令对该界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;发送该新的应用程序的本文档来自技高网
...
界面处理方法、装置及系统

【技术保护点】
一种界面处理方法,其特征在于,包括:获取机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;根据所述描述信息生成与该描述信息对应的界面呈现元素;接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。

【技术特征摘要】
1.一种界面处理方法,其特征在于,包括:获取机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;根据所述描述信息生成与该描述信息对应的界面呈现元素;接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。2.根据权利要求1所述的方法,其特征在于,所述生成新的应用程序的界面和/或新的操作描述信息之后,所述方法还包括:将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。3.根据权利要求1或2所述的方法,其特征在于,所述接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令包括以下至少之一:接收对控件位置、大小的拖拽指令;接收对控件的皮肤、贴图的替换指令;接收对控件的点击、长按的业务编辑指令。4.一种界面处理方法,其特征在于,包括:终端构建机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;所述终端根据所述描述信息生成与该描述信息对应的界面呈现元素;所述终端接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令,根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息;所述终端发送所述新的应用程序的界面和/或新的操作描述信息给所述机顶盒。5.根据权利要求4所述的方法,其特征在于,所述根据所述编辑指令对所述界面呈现元素进行编辑生成新的应用程序的界面和/或新的操作描述信息之后,所述方法还包括:将所述新的应用程序的界面和/或新的操作描述信息中网络链接对应的图片发送给机顶盒。6.根据权利要求4或5所述的方法,其特征在于,所述终端接收对所述界面呈现元素的属性和/或业务逻辑的编辑指令包括以下至少之一:接收对控件位置、大小的拖拽指令;接收对控件的皮肤、贴图的替换指令;接收对控件的点击、长按的业务编辑指令。7.一种界面处理方法,其特征在于,包括:接收编辑后的新的应用程序的界面和/或新的操作描述信息,其中,所述新的应用程序的界面和/或新的操作描述信息是终端通过对机顶盒的应用程序的界面和/或操作描述信息对应界面呈现元素的属性和/或业务逻辑进行编辑生成;根据所述新的应用程序的界面和/或新的操作描述信息对所述机顶盒应用程序的界面和/或业务操作进行动态调整。8.根据权利要求7所述的方法,其特征在于,所述根据所述新的应用程序的界面和/或新的所述应用程序的操作描述信息对所述机顶盒应用程序的界面和/或业务操作进行动态调整包括以下至少之一:根据所述描述信息中的界面样式和/或布局对应用程序中预置的界面呈现元素进行展示或隐藏,并调整所述界面呈现元素的布局和/或尺寸;接收所述界面和/或操作描述信息的相关图片替换界面呈现元素的皮肤贴图;根据所述描述信息中规定的界面呈现元素操作,定义界面呈现元素的业务操作。9.一种界面处理装置,其特征在于,包括:获取模块,用于获取机顶盒的应用程序的界面和/或所述应用程序的操作描述信息;第一编辑模块,用于根据所述描述...

【专利技术属性】
技术研发人员:崔志伟
申请(专利权)人:中兴通讯股份有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1